使用此标记来了解有关PowerMock的问题,PowerMock是一个用于为类和方法创建模拟对象的Java库。关于PowerMock对Mockito的扩展的问题应该标记为[powermockito]。
本地单元测试中Build.VERSION.SDK_INT的存根值
我想知道是否有办法存根 Build.Version.SDK_INT 的值?假设我在 ClassUnderTest 中有以下几行: 如果(Build.VERSION.SDK_INT >= Build.VERSION_CODES.JELLY_BE...
我想在 JUnit 5 中模拟静态方法。但不幸的是,JUnit 5 不支持 Mockito。除了恢复到 JUnit 4 之外,还有其他方法可以实现相同的目的吗?
我一直在开发一个android项目,并使用roboletric和powermock进行单元测试。 当我运行 gradle jacocoTestReport 时,它会显示 [ant:jacocoReport] 捆绑包“app”中的类与...
模拟java elasticsearch RestHighLevelClient
我想像这样模拟RestHighLevelClient:RestHighLevelClient client = mock(RestHighLevelClient.class);,但是当我这样做时,它说模拟的客户端为空。就像它不恰当地嘲笑一样。那么什么...
PowerMock/Mockito 无法获取 Class 中的 mock 值
我模拟了 QueryService,通过 when/doReturn 为查询服务中的函数设置返回值, 当我运行测试时发现 ResultDTO 结果为空。 我是单元测试的新手...
org.powermock.reflect.exceptions.MethodNotFoundException:找不到名称为“”且参数类型为:[java.util.LinkedList]
我正在使用 PowerMock 开发测试类,因为我所有的遗留代码都是使用 Private Static methods() 编写的。 运行测试类时,出现以下错误: org.powermock.reflect.except...
我有一个看起来像这样的类: A类{ 私人决赛 B b; 公共 A(字符串 x,字符串 y){ b = 新 B(x,y); } public void someMethod() { b.外部方法(); ...
How to mock the @ value using power mock not with Mockito?
需要使用power mockito而不是使用Mockito来设置服务类的@Value。 尝试使用 Reflection.utils(class , name , value) 设置值它不起作用,因为该类正在使用
我在 scala 中有一个静态方法,静态方法我的意思是说这个方法在一个名为 MyObject 的对象中。我还有一个名为 MyClass 的类,其中有一个调用
如何在从 BaseClass 调用的抽象类中模拟受保护的方法
更新原始问题。 我会把原始代码块放上去,然后再提出问题。 被测类 包我的.main.class.package; 公共类 MyClassHelper 扩展 MySession { //塞西...
如何模拟从 BaseClass 调用的抽象类中的受保护方法 [关闭]
更新原始问题。 我会把原始代码块放上去,然后再提出问题。 被测类 包我的.main.class.package; 公共类 MyClassHelper 扩展 MySession { //塞西...
我正在尝试使用 Junit/Mockito/PowerMockito 我有一个接口类 导入 retrofit2.Call; 导入com.learning.model.user.User; 导入java.io.IOException; 公共接口 UserServi...
Spring Boot中如何使用Mockito验证单元测试@Slf4j登录
我需要将记录器作为模拟注入并验证日志方法调用而不创建自定义附加程序。但是我无法用这种方法验证日志方法调用。 @
在 java 中使用 powerMock 类新对象模拟的测试用例
我正在尝试模拟在另一个类中创建的用户的类实例,该类是 MyClass 方法计数。 我想为 Myclass 方法计数编写单元测试用例 下面是示例代码 我...
在方法级别重写@PrepareForTest 会抛出“未找到匹配方法的测试”
我收到错误 “java.lang.Exception:找不到与方法 test456 匹配的测试” 尝试在方法级别覆盖 @PrepareForTest 时。 以下是我的班级结构 @PrepareFor...
PowerMock.VerifyStatic 替代 mockito
PowerMock.verifyStatic(Util.class) 我在 powermockito 中使用这个方法来验证这个类,我需要在 mockito 中使用什么方法来验证类似的行为?
我试图使用testfx、junit和powermock来为我的javafx应用程序植入一些测试。当我从我的intellij ide上运行这些测试时,它们运行得很好。在gradle的 "test "任务上运行它们... ...
我正试图为我的一个项目编写JUnit测试用例,我试图模拟一个对象映射器并在测试用例中使用它。但是当我尝试调试junit测试用例时,它立即失败了......。
我在使用TestNG和PowerMock的时候,总是抛出没有准备好测试的类。
@PrepareForTest(DataAccessorFactory.class) @ContextConfiguration(loves = { "test_jooq-spring.xml" }) public class WorkspaceManagerTest extends AbstractTestNGSpringContextTests { @ ...
如何在不创建新目录的情况下检查if?String st = "exemple"; String path = "exemple"; if (!new File(path).resences() && !new File(path).mkdirs()) { throw new ComumException("..."。